When looking to attend the right community college in Hope, Arkansas, there are several important things you should consider before applying. First, you should look at whether the school has the degree program you are looking for. Additionally, find out what the course offerings are because you might find another Hope, Arkansas community college that offers more classes in an aspect of the subject area in which you want to work. Comparing the various technical schools and community colleges in Hope, Arkansas will give you a good idea of what it will take to complete a program in Hope, Arkansas and the types of work you will have to do once in the work force. You might find out that this program area isn't right for you but a different one is.

Second, you should look at the time constraints and flexibility of scheduling at each Hope, Arkansas technical college or community college of interest to you. You don't want to enroll in a program and then find out that it's scheduling of classes doesn't work with the other responsibilities you may have. Another aspect of this is to find out how long the Hope, Arkansas technical school program will take to be completed. Some programs take longer than others and many people can only be without a job for so long.

The last factor one should consider is whether the Hope, Arkansas community college or technical school program will help you further your career. If it does not offer the classes you want to take in order to be prepared for the real world, then chances are this program is not worth the time and money spent attending it. However, if the classes seem of interest to you and you feel the Hope, Arkansas community college will give you valuable training that will make you confident in your ability to carry out your job as a professional then, the program is definitely worth considering.
